Intuit Collections Manager Salaries in Washington, DC

The average Intuit Collections Manager in Washington, DC earns an estimated $68,032 annually. Intuit's Collections Manager compensation is $1,508 more than the US average for a Collections Manager.

In Washington, DC, The Finance Department at Intuit earns $19,691 more on average than the Operations Department.

Collections Manager Compensation by Gender (All Companies)

The average female Collections Manager at companies similar size to Intuit reported making $76,765, while the average male Collections Manager at similar sized companies reported making $80,729.

Collections Manager Compensation by Ethnicity (All Companies)

The average Caucasian Collections Manager at companies similar size to Intuit reported making $73,306, while the average Hispanic or Latino Collections Manager at similar sized companies reported making $56,800.

How Collections Managers at Intuit Rate Their Compensation

The majority of Collections Managers at Intuit believe they're compensated fairly. 77% of Collections Managers at Intuit say they receive annual bonuses, and the vast majority (89%) are satisfied with their benefits. See more compensation ratings at Intuit
